Begin your day by visiting the world's tallest building, the Burj Khalifa. Marvel at its impressive architecture and panoramic views of the city from the observation deck on the 148th floor. Estimated cost: Admission to the observation deck starts from AED 149 per person.
Time spent: Approximately 2 hours.
Head over to the Dubai Mall, located adjacent to Burj Khalifa. Explore this vast shopping destination with over 1,300 stores, including renowned international brands and luxury boutiques. Enjoy a leisurely stroll through the mall and take a break to admire the mesmerizing Dubai Aquarium and Underwater Zoo.
Estimated cost: Free admission to the mall. Additional charges apply for attractions within the mall.
Time spent: Approximately 3 hours.
Next, make your way to the stunning Jumeirah Mosque. This beautiful mosque is an architectural masterpiece and one of the few mosques in Dubai that welcomes non-Muslim visitors. Learn about Islamic culture and traditions while taking in the intricate details of the mosque's design.
Estimated cost: Admission is AED 20 per person.
Time spent: Approximately 1 hour.
Experience the charm of Old Dubai by visiting the historic Dubai Creek. Take an abra (traditional wooden boat) ride across the creek and immerse yourself in the bustling atmosphere of the traditional souks. Explore the Spice Souk and Gold Souk, where you can find a dazzling array of spices, perfumes, and exquisite jewelry.
Estimated cost: Abra ride costs AED 1 per person. Shopping expenses vary.
Time spent: Approximately 2 hours.

For a unique experience, venture beyond the popular tourist attractions and explore the Al Fahidi Historic District. Discover the authentic charm of Dubai's oldest neighborhood, filled with narrow alleyways, traditional courtyard houses, and art galleries. Visit the Dubai Museum, housed in the 18th-century Al Fahidi Fort, to gain insight into the city's rich history.
Indulge in Emirati cuisine by trying local specialties such as shawarma, falafel, and camel meat dishes. Don't miss out on experiencing a traditional Emirati breakfast at a local restaurant, where you can savor dishes like balaleet (sweetened vermicelli with saffron) and chebab (Emirati pancakes).
